Software Development Engineer, Consensus and Distributed Locking Systems, Transactional Services
2 settimane fa
Software Development Engineer, Consensus and Distributed Locking Systems, Transactional ServicesJob ID: | Amazon.com Services LLCJoin the team that powers distributed consensus across AWS. We build and maintain the systems that enable distributed consensus for locks, leader election, group membership and work distribution across AWS. Our distributed computing primitives are part of the critical building blocks behind services like S3, DynamoDB, CloudWatch, and more.This role offers a unique opportunity to solve complex distributed systems challenges that impact services across AWS. We are looking for engineers who thrive on technical challenges and are passionate about building highly available, durable systems with minimal dependencies. You will collaborate with talented peers to design and implement robust solutions, make critical architectural decisions, and ensure operational excellence. If you are excited about distributed systems engineering and the opportunity to build and operate systems with impact across AWS services, this role is for you.Key job responsibilitiesYou work with the team to design, build, and operate systems that are stable, highly available, and performant.You solve difficult problems, applying appropriate technologies and architectural patterns.You are proficient in a broad range of design approaches and know when it is appropriate to use them (and when it is not). Your solutions are pragmatic and navigate constraints.You create maintainable software without over-engineering. You make appropriate trade‑offs, re‑use where possible, and are judicious about introducing dependencies.You focus on operational excellence, understanding how decisions impact operational costs, and take on projects that make software easier to maintain.A day in the lifeDesigning and driving technical decisions that balance competing priorities and constraints.Implementing changes at a high quality while meeting stringent requirements for availability, durability, and performance.Creating and implementing automation that improves system reliability and operational efficiency.Working closely with dependent teams to enhance system capabilities and resolve technical challenges.Driving investigations to root cause anomalies and delivering robust solutions.About the teamWe are a team that believes in focused execution and collaboration. We concentrate our collective energy on 1–2 key initiatives, allowing us to deliver high‑quality results through teamwork. Learning is central to our team’s operation—we’re constantly sharing knowledge and growing together with technical deep‑dives and demos. We love good debates that evaluate multiple perspectives and approaches to arrive at thoughtful decisions on critical questions.Operational excellence isn’t just a goal—it’s a critical requirement in our work. We strive for continuous improvement, believing that this pursuit strengthens both our systems and our engineering skills.Basic Qualifications3+ years of non‑internship professional software development experience.2+ years of non‑internship design or architecture (design patterns, reliability, and scaling) of new and existing systems.Experience programming with at least one software programming language.Preferred Qualifications3+ years of full software development life cycle experience, including coding standards, code reviews, source control management, build processes, testing, and operations.Bachelor’s degree in computer science or equivalent.Knowledge of distributed computing environments.Amazon is an equal opportunity employer and does not discriminate on the basis of protected veteran status, disability, or other legally protected status.Our inclusive culture empowers Amazonians to deliver the best results for our customers. If you have a disability and need a workplace accommodation or adjustment during the application and hiring process, including support for the interview or onboarding process, please visit for more information. If the country/region you’re applying in isn’t listed, please contact your Recruiting Partner.Our compensation reflects the cost of labor across several US geographic markets. The base pay for this position ranges from $129,300/year in our lowest geographic market up to $223,600/year in our highest geographic market. Pay is based on a number of factors including market location and may vary depending on job‑related knowledge, skills, and experience. Amazon is a total compensation company. Dependent on the position offered, equity, sign‑on payments, and other forms of compensation may be provided as part of a total compensation package, in addition to a full range of medical, financial, and/or other benefits. For more information, please visit This position will remain posted until filled. Applicants should apply via our internal or external career site.Amazon is an equal opportunity employer and does not discriminate on the basis of protected veteran status, disability, or other legally protected status.#J-18808-Ljbffr
-
Milan, Italia Vendita al dettaglio e all'ingrosso Import-export A tempo pienoSoftware Development Engineer, Consensus and Distributed Locking Systems, Transactional Services Job ID: | Amazon.com Services LLCJoin the team that powers distributed consensus across AWS. We build and maintain the systems that enable distributed consensus for locks, leader election, group membership and work distribution across AWS. Our distributed...
-
Distributed Systems Engineer: Consensus
2 settimane fa
Milan, Italia Vendita al dettaglio e all'ingrosso Import-export A tempo pienoA leading technology company is seeking a Software Development Engineer to tackle complex challenges in distributed systems. This role requires at least 3 years of professional software development experience and 2 years of architecture design. You will design and implement robust solutions with a focus on operational excellence. Located in Italy, this...
-
Software Development Engineer, Ring Data Streaming Services
2 settimane fa
Milan, Italia Vendita al dettaglio e all'ingrosso Import-export A tempo pienoSoftware Development Engineer, Ring Data Streaming Services The Ring Data Streaming Services team is at the forefront of building next‑generation event processing platforms that power mission‑critical customer experiences and AI‑driven innovations across Ring, Blink, Key, and Sidewalk (RBKS). We’re looking for a Software Development Engineer to lead...
-
Lead Golang Software Engineer, Commercial Systems
2 settimane fa
Milan, Italia Altro A tempo pienoLead Golang Software Engineer, Commercial Systems The role of Lead Golang Software Engineer at Canonical focuses on designing, developing, and operating key services that power the Commercial Systems unit. Canonical is a leading provider of open‑source software and operating systems, with Ubuntu as its flagship platform used by public cloud providers,...
-
Lead Golang Engineer, Commercial Systems — Remote
2 settimane fa
Milan, Italia Altro A tempo pienoA leading tech firm is seeking a Lead Golang Software Engineer to design and develop key services for their Commercial Systems unit. The role involves leading technical design, conducting code reviews, and mentoring colleagues in a remote working environment across the EMEA region. Candidates should have a strong background in Golang development, exceptional...
-
Software Engineer, AI Gateway
1 settimana fa
Milan, Italia Kong A tempo pienoA leading developer in cloud API technologies is seeking a Software Engineer for their AI Gateway Team in Milano, Italy. This role involves building and maintaining API management software, implementing features, and optimizing performance. Candidates should have 3+ years of programming experience and strong Linux troubleshooting skills, along with a solid...
-
Milan, Italia Canonical A tempo pienoCanonical is a leading provider of open-source software and operating systems for global enterprise and technology markets. Our platform, Ubuntu, is very widely used in breakthrough enterprise initiatives such as public cloud, data science, AI, engineering innovation and IoT. Our customers include the world’s leading public cloud and silicon providers, and...
-
Software Engineer, AI Gateway
1 settimana fa
Milan, Italia Kong Inc. A tempo pienoAre you ready to power the World’s connections?If you don’t think you meet all of the criteria below but are still interested in the job, please apply. Nobody checks every box - we’re looking for candidates that are particularly strong in a few areas, and have some interest and capabilities in others.About The RoleYou will join the engineering team...
-
Systems Engineer, Managed Operations
1 settimana fa
Milan, Italia Vendita al dettaglio e all'ingrosso Import-export A tempo pienoJob ID: | Amazon Development Centre Ireland Limited AWS is set to introduce the inaugural European Sovereign Cloud (ESC), marking a significant development in Utility Computing (UC). To spearhead this initiative, we are actively seeking experienced systems engineers with a strong background in cloud operations. As part of the AWS Managed Operations team, you...
-
Key account manager italy
5 giorni fa
Milan, Italia Beta Systems Software A tempo pienoBeta Systems Software is an ISV (Independent Software Vendor), a global leader in IT automation, security, mainframe optimization, and compliance solutions for complex enterprise environments.Founded in 1983 and headquartered in Berlin, Germany, Beta Systems operates through 25 subsidiaries worldwide. For over 40 years, the company has empowered leading...